技术文档

服务器 生成https证书

时间 : 2024-11-30 10:10:01浏览量 : 2

在当今数字化的时代,网络安全至关重要,而 HTTPS 证书则是构建安全网络环境的关键组成部分。服务器生成 HTTPS 证书,为网站和用户之间的通信提供了加密和身份验证,确保数据的安全传输和网站的可信度。

HTTPS 证书,全称为 Hypertext Transfer Protocol Secure,是一种用于在互联网上加密通信的技术协议。它通过使用 SSL/TLS 加密算法,对网站与用户之间传输的数据进行加密,防止数据被窃取、篡改或中间人攻击。同时,HTTPS 证书还可以验证网站的身份,确保用户访问的是真实的、可信任的网站,而不是仿冒或欺诈网站。

服务器生成 HTTPS 证书的过程涉及到一系列的技术和步骤。服务器需要向证书颁发机构(CA)提出证书申请。CA 会对服务器的身份进行验证,确保申请证书的服务器是合法的、可信的。验证过程可能包括检查服务器的域名所有权、身份信息等。

一旦服务器的身份通过验证,CA 将会生成一个数字证书,并将其颁发给服务器。这个数字证书包含了服务器的公钥、域名信息、证书有效期等重要信息。服务器将收到的证书安装在其服务器上,并在与用户进行通信时,使用证书中的公钥对数据进行加密。

用户在访问使用 HTTPS 证书的网站时,浏览器会自动验证网站的证书是否合法。浏览器会检查证书的颁发机构是否可信、证书的有效期是否过期、证书中的域名是否与访问的域名一致等。如果证书验证通过,浏览器会与服务器建立安全的加密连接,并在页面地址栏中显示一个锁图标,表示该网站是安全的。

生成 HTTPS 证书不仅可以保障用户的隐私和数据安全,还可以提升网站的可信度和搜索引擎排名。在搜索引擎优化(SEO)方面,使用 HTTPS 证书的网站通常会被搜索引擎视为更安全、更可靠的网站,从而给予更高的排名权重。一些浏览器和操作系统也会对使用 HTTPS 证书的网站进行标记,提醒用户注意网站的安全性。

然而,生成和管理 HTTPS 证书也需要一定的技术和管理成本。服务器需要定期更新证书,以确保其有效性和安全性。同时,还需要妥善保管证书的私钥,防止私钥泄露导致证书被伪造或攻击。对于一些小型网站或个人网站来说,自行生成和管理 HTTPS 证书可能会比较复杂和困难,可以考虑使用一些免费的证书颁发机构或托管服务。

服务器生成 HTTPS 证书是保障网络安全和信任的重要措施。它通过加密通信和验证身份,为用户提供了安全的网络环境,同时也提升了网站的可信度和搜索引擎排名。在数字化时代,我们应该重视 HTTPS 证书的作用,积极采取措施生成和使用 HTTPS 证书,共同构建一个安全、可靠的网络世界。